Getting from Stansted Airport (STN) to central London
Stansted Airport to the centre of London has a drive time of around 1 hour. It's approximately 64 kilometres away.
Getting there on public transport will take you around 1 hour 25 minutes.
When to fly to Stansted Airport (STN)
It's time to work out your dates for your flight from Innsbruck Airport to Stansted Airport. August is the most popular month to visit London. If you like a more low-key vibe, go in April.
Lock in your flight from Innsbruck Airport to Stansted Airport for July if you'd like to go to London during its warmest month. You can expect temperatures of between 11ºC (52ºF) and 26ºC (79ºF).
Look for cheap tickets from INN to STN in January if you want to travel in c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between 0ºC (32ºF) and 9ºC (48ºF) on average.
